The biliary excretion of trypsin in rats
Authors:David A. W. Grant  Simon C. Fleming
Affiliation:(1) Department of Surgery, St. George's Hospital Medical School, SW17 ORE London, UK
Abstract:The serum half-life of bovine [3H]acetyltrypsin was estimated to be 9 rain following intravenous administration in rats. This was maintained when six successive doses of 200 mgrg each were given at 1-h intervals. The enzyme was removed from the circulation after complexing with agr2-macroglobulin (agr2-M). The amount of3H label appearing in bile increased with each successive dose and this was associated with breakdown products (<10 000 daltons) of the agr2–M/[3H] acetyltrypsin. Intact agr–M/[3H] acetyltrypsin was recovered from bile but represented only 0.06% of the administered dose of active enzyme.
